I suspect Bill is right about that Ivor, that rear fitting should be for the PCV. Now how you plumb it though... that depends. There are at least 2 or three ways to skin this cat but there are also several wrong ways and if you do it wrong the usual result is an oily mess. So spend some time making sure you do it right.

The basic configuration falls into one of three camps: American, British, and open.

The American system uses a PCV valve in one rocker cover plumbed to the carb and a large (5/8" or 3/4") vent plumbed to the air cleaner through a flame trap. Usually the carb fitting is unrestricted. At cruise fresh air is drawn in on one side, out the other and into the carb. Under WOT blowby goes out the large tube into the air cleaner.

The British system is difficult to fully understand apparently, hopefully someone who is intimately familiar with it can explain it here. It uses a filtered orifice on one side and a large vent tube and flame trap on the other, plumbed into the intake somehow, but my testing indicates that if that line is exposed to full manifold vacuum the idle becomes uncontrollable due to air leakage past the seals. Wasn't with that carb though, and it could possibly restrict the PCV at idle. You'd need to check. You wouldn't want a restriction in that line at WOT though because then you'll blow oil past all your seals.

The open system simply vents the crankcase to atmosphere.

I would remove that orifice fitting from the carb, plumb your PCV line in there, and route the hose from the Lucas flame trap to the base of the air filter. Many have an installable fitting for that purpose. You may need to tune the carb for the possible increase in air.

The front port on the carb is designed for use as the PCV port Ivor.
The rear port is intended for use as a vacuum take off for accessories such as power brakes.
The front port is designed in a manner that mixes the incoming vapors with the fuel emulsion from the primary circuit at low throttle angles.
The rear port just dumps directly into the intake plenum potentially allowing oil vapors to condense and pool on the intake floor.
In reality either one works just fine for either purpose.
Your carb looks to be set up for the European style of ventilation. So it might be easiest to use that system.
There is a good write-up somewhere in here on the various PCV systems and their various advantages.
But to answer your question, certainly you can drill out the plug and use the port.

Ivor, you've seen the amount of blowby at idle, now imagine what that's going to be under full load. THAT is the main issue you are dealing with, and if you think for an instant that you can suck it all through a 3/8" tube you are deluding yourself. As the engine gets older it just gets worse.

You've got basically 3 choices here. Vent to atmo, suck it down the carb throat, or find some way to introduce it to the intake behind the carb without completely screwing up your idle. Sounds like you are leaning towards the 3rd choice. The danger is too much on one end and too little on the other. I've plumbed mine through a 5/8" vacuum controlled heater valve and so far it works, but it's a unique solution. If you thoroughly investigate the methods used on modern engines you may find something that will work for you. I think most use electronic controls these days.

I dunno, maybe you can find a European car that used a 4bbl V8 and copy that system. That would probably be the easiest for you. But don't cut corners thinking you can overlook any element of the system, it'll bite you if you do. You need to fully understand how it works in all phases and it is a complex system. Much more complicated in operation than on this side because you actively involve the engine seals.

Now as for sending it through the carb, yeah it isn't optimal but it's been proven to work over decades of factory cars. The blowby has already combusted so it tends to richen the mixture as it goes through the carb and reduces the effective airflow as well. The oil and combustion byproducts it carries can dirty the carb but most is washed off by gasoline. American manufacturers used that system from the mid 60's up until EFI overtook it and not without good reasons. Even so, the functioning of the PCV valve itself is not commonly understood at all, and for such a simple device it's operating phases are complex. It needs to be carefully selected and then properly installed, best done by copying factory specs.

You can drill out the plug in the front port and tap it to 1/4" pipe thread (NPT)
Then you can put in any fitting that you wish.
No it's not ideal to vent the PCV to the rear of the carb but it works.
You will get the odd puff of smoke due to oil pooling from time to time.
That's why the front port is routed to mix the vapors with the incoming idle fuel mix.
GM did use the rear port for awhile but emissions rules dictated a change to the front 50 or so years ago.
Use the "ported" or timed vacuum port on the right hand side of the carb for your distributor.
The old "full manifold' vacuum method was used to aid the old weak starters by retarding the timing when cranking.
The timed port improves throttle response, reduces stalling and lessens emissions.
If I were doing it I would run the flame arrester hose to the air filter and drill out the filter on the left valve cover for a PCV valve. Run a hose to the front of the carb, and you're done. Now I could pretend that I have suddenly become all knowledgable on this subject, but actually I swiped this from elsewhere:

The vacuum advance modules that were originally fitted to the early Rover engines offered slight variations in their operationg points. Some would range from 4" Hg to 15"Hg, whilst others ranged from 4"Hg to 20"Hg. The actual degrees of advance provided was typically 8 degrees at the distributor thus 16 degrees at the crankshaft.

The vacuum advance modules available today [this was 2009] for the Rover V8 have been standardised, with one module being supplied as an OEM for all engines that had such modules fitted. These modules provide vacuum advance from 5"Hg to 17"Hg and will see 8 degrees at the distributor thus 16 degrees at the crankshaft of advance.

Vacuum advance as it applies to the Rover V8 with SU carburettors is a ported system, with the vacuum supply point being before the butterfly therefore no vacuum advance is provided at idle. When cruising with minimal throttle opening, vacuum is high so typically the module will be providing essentially its fully rated maximum advance,..ie 16 degrees, while at greater throttle openings ranging upto full throttle, vacuum will continue to diminish so the supplied advance will also decline until none is supplied..
